summ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Bram Moolenaar <Bram@vim.org>2017-09-30 14:39:27 +0200
committerBram Moolenaar <Bram@vim.org>2017-09-30 14:39:27 +0200
commitc79977a437d91306d576fb59e490601409503303 (patch)
tree12b331fec005adb90ca6b109676e6ef185db221f
parent660b85e39a48a9f2e3bd7e4d8b97d0a1b4842997 (diff)
downloadvim-git-c79977a437d91306d576fb59e490601409503303.tar.gz
patch 8.0.1163: popup test is flakyv8.0.1163
Problem: Popup test is flaky. Solution: Add a WaitFor() and fix another.
-rw-r--r--src/testdir/test_popup.vim5
-rw-r--r--src/version.c2
2 files changed, 5 insertions, 2 deletions
diff --git a/src/testdir/test_popup.vim b/src/testdir/test_popup.vim
index a42ec64a2..4ab860b81 100644
--- a/src/testdir/test_popup.vim
+++ b/src/testdir/test_popup.vim
@@ -649,14 +649,15 @@ func Test_popup_and_window_resize()
call term_wait(g:buf, 100)
call term_sendkeys(g:buf, "\<c-v>")
call term_wait(g:buf, 100)
+ call WaitFor('term_getline(g:buf, 1) =~ "^!"')
call assert_match('^!\s*$', term_getline(g:buf, 1))
exe 'resize +' . (h - 1)
call term_wait(g:buf, 100)
redraw!
- call WaitFor('"" == term_getline(g:buf, 1)')
+ call WaitFor('term_getline(g:buf, 1) == ""')
call assert_equal('', term_getline(g:buf, 1))
sleep 100m
- call WaitFor('"^!" =~ term_getline(g:buf, term_getcursor(g:buf)[0] + 1)')
+ call WaitFor('term_getline(g:buf, term_getcursor(g:buf)[0] + 1) =~ "^!"')
call assert_match('^!\s*$', term_getline(g:buf, term_getcursor(g:buf)[0] + 1))
bwipe!
endfunc
diff --git a/src/version.c b/src/version.c
index 778046b95..dc9be43c5 100644
--- a/src/version.c
+++ b/src/version.c
@@ -762,6 +762,8 @@ static char *(features[]) =
static int included_patches[] =
{ /* Add new patch number below this line */
/**/
+ 1163,
+/**/
1162,
/**/
1161,